What are some typical challenges faced by computer science professionals in unionized environments?

Computer science professionals in unionized settings often face unique challenges such as balancing organizational technology goals with collectively bargained work agreements and navigating structured processes for workflow changes or new initiatives. Adhering to union regulations can add extra layers of documentation and collaboration, especially when implementing new systems or managing cross-team projects. However, these environments also offer clear protocols for conflict resolution, opportunities for professional development, and strong support systems. Successfully adapting to these dynamics not only enhances project outcomes but also supports a positive and equitable work culture.

What is a union computer science?

A Union Computer Science job refers to a position in the tech industry that falls under a labor union, meaning employees have collective bargaining rights for fair wages, benefits, and working conditions. These jobs can exist in various sectors, including government, education, and private industries where unions are established. Workers in these roles may benefit from job security, standardized pay scales, and grievance procedures. Unionization in computer science helps ensure fair treatment and advocate for workers' rights in an ever-evolving industry.

The Application Engineer is responsible for the end-to-end ownership, support, enhancement, and operational stability of assigned Commercial Off-The-Shelf (COTS) applications and associated data integrations. This role partners closely with business stakeholders, vendors, and technology teams to deliver reliable, scalable, and secure solutions that meet organizational needs. 

The ideal candidate possesses strong application support, cloud, and data engineering experience, along with a passion for automation and continuous improvement. This individual will be responsible for maintaining production systems, managing data pipelines, supporting Agile delivery teams, and leveraging emerging technologies, including Generative AI, to improve operational efficiency and business outcomes.

Navy Federal Credit Union, based in Vienna, Virginia, United States, is a significant player in the financial services industry. Their official website is navyfederal.org. With its roots dating back to 1933, it was initially established to provide credit to Navy members. Over the years, Navy Federal has magnified its scope, evolving into a full-service credit union serving all branches of the military, the Department of Defense, veterans, and their families. The company’s core values include integrity, service, education, and leadership. Navy Federal aims to be the most preferred and trusted financial institution serving the military and their families.
